What to Write in a Funeral Thank-You Card for Friends
- “Thank you for your unwavering support and comforting words during this difficult time. Your presence and kindness have meant the world to us, and we are grateful for your friendship.”
- “We extend heartfelt thanks for your comforting presence, kind words, and unwavering support during this challenging period. Your friendship has been a source of strength, and we are truly grateful.”
- “Thank you for your friendship and the comforting presence you provided during this difficult time. Your support and understanding have been a source of solace, and we are grateful for your unwavering friendship.”
- “Our heartfelt thanks for your friendship, kind words, and unwavering support during this challenging period. Your comforting presence has made a significant impact, and we are grateful for your friendship.”
- “Thank you for being a true friend during this difficult time. Your comforting words, understanding, and unwavering support have been a source of strength, and we are truly grateful for your friendship.”
- “We extend heartfelt thanks for your friendship, kind gestures, and unwavering support during this challenging period. Your presence and comforting words have made a significant impact, and we are grateful for your friendship.”
- “Thank you for your unwavering friendship and the comforting presence you provided during this difficult time. Your support and understanding have been a source of solace, and we are grateful for your friendship.”
- “Our heartfelt thanks for your friendship and the unwavering support you’ve provided during this challenging period. Your comforting words and presence have made a significant impact, and we are grateful for your friendship.”

What to Write in a Funeral Thank You Card: Check 100+ Messages
The loss of a loved one is an emotionally challenging experience, and during such difficult times, the support and condolences from friends, family, coworkers, and well-wishers play a crucial role in providing comfort and solace. Expressing gratitude through a funeral thank-you card is a thoughtful way to acknowledge the sympathy and support received, offering a chance to reflect on the shared grief and express appreciation for the kindness extended.
